Instructions
- 1. In a large pot, heat 2 tbsp of oil over medium heat. Add 1 finely chopped onion, 1 diced green pepper, and 2 minced garlic cloves. Sauté for 5-7 minutes until softened.
- 2. Add 1 cup of cooked and mashed red kidney beans to the pot. Cook, stirring occasionally, for 8-10 minutes to develop flavor.
- 3. Stir in 4 diced tomatoes, 2 tsp cumin seeds, 1 tsp salt, and 1 tsp pepper. Cook for 5 minutes to combine the flavors.
- 4. Add 4 cups of tomato sauce and 3 cups of whole red kidney beans. Stir well and bring the mixture to a boil.
- 5. Reduce the heat to low, cover the pot, and let the chili simmer for 1 hour, stirring occasionally.
- 6. Uncover the pot and continue to simmer on low heat for an additional hour, stirring occasionally, until the chili reaches your desired thickness.
- 7. Serve hot with your favorite toppings such as chopped cilantro, shredded cheese, or a dollop of sour cream.
